FYI: Swing Flag Edge

Just wanted to give y’all a heads up!  When we order the silk for the swing flags, we don’t know if the yardage will have a woven selvedge or unwoven (those are the sides on the loom while the silk is being made).  On a couple of our recent batches it’s been an unwoven selvedge that include a white thread at the very edge that doesn’t take dye.   Continue reading FYI: Swing Flag Edge
